How Often Should You Replace Your Sump Pump Battery?

To ensure your sump pump's reliable operation in a power failure, it's vital to replace the battery periodically. Most brands advise replacing your sump pump battery each five years. However, this is just a standard guideline; the actual lifespan can vary based on elements like performance, temperature, and unit grade. It’s in addition a good idea to check your battery monthly to assess its present strength and ensure it can manage a power interruption.

Choosing the Right Battery for Your Sump Pump

Selecting the appropriate power source for a drainage unit is crucial for safeguarding the home from flooding. Think about the ampere-hour rating, which determines how much the backup system can sustain power during an electrical failure. Additionally check the output, typically 12V , to verify agreement with the pump's specifications . Lastly , opt for a deep cycle battery designed for frequent depletion and recharge cycles.

Sump Pump Battery Replacement: Troubleshooting & Tips

Replacing your sump pump's battery can be a straightforward task, but difficulties can arise. If your system isn't working after the replacement, check the battery connections are secure. A frequent mistake is switching the plus and minus terminals – always double-check the alignment! Furthermore, the battery might be worn despite looking new; consider a battery capacity test. Finally, review the float – a faulty float may prevent the pump from starting, even with a charged battery. Sometimes, a electrical spike can harm the battery, so using a voltage protector is recommended.
